Hepimiz biliyoruz ki, web sitesi hızının SEO üzerindeki etkisi oldukça büyük. Google’ın sıralama algoritmasında hız önemli bir faktör olarak yer alıyor. Ancak hız sadece SEO için değil, ziyaretçilerin web sitenizde geçireceği süreyi de doğrudan etkiler. Yavaş yüklenen bir site, kullanıcı deneyimini olumsuz etkileyebilir ve bu da potansiyel müşterilerinizi kaybetmenize neden olabilir. Peki, web hosting performansını nasıl artırabilirsiniz? İşte bilmediğiniz, sunucu kaynaklı hız problemlerini çözmek için kullanabileceğiniz 10 pratik yöntem.
1. CDN Kullanımının Önemi ve Hız Üzerindeki Etkisi
Web sitenizin hızını artırmanın en etkili yollarından biri, CDN (Content Delivery Network) kullanmaktır. CDN, statik dosyalarınızı (resimler, CSS dosyaları, JavaScript gibi) dünyanın farklı noktalarındaki sunuculara kopyalar ve ziyaretçilerinize en yakın sunucudan içerik gönderir. Bu sayede, kullanıcıların uzak mesafelerdeki sunuculardan veri almasını engelleyerek sayfa yükleme süresini ciddi oranda düşürür.
CDN kullanarak, yalnızca hız değil, güvenlik ve web sitenizin ulaşılabilirliği de artar. Özellikle dünya çapında geniş bir kullanıcı kitleniz varsa, CDN sayesinde hızlı ve sorunsuz bir deneyim sunabilirsiniz.
2. Nginx ve Apache Karşılaştırması: Hangisi Daha Hızlı?
Web sitenizin hızını etkileyen önemli faktörlerden biri de kullandığınız web sunucusudur. Apache ve Nginx en yaygın kullanılan iki web sunucusudur. Apache, özellikle esnekliği ve geniş eklenti desteği ile bilinirken, Nginx ise hız ve verimlilik konusunda öne çıkar. Nginx, statik dosyalar için daha iyi bir performans sunarken, Apache dinamik içerikler için tercih edilebilir.
Hangi sunucu yazılımını seçtiğiniz, sitenizin hızını doğrudan etkileyebilir. Eğer hız önceliğinizse, Nginx'i tercih etmek mantıklı olacaktır.3. Web Cache ve Dinamik İçerik Optimizasyonu
Dinamik içerik, her kullanıcı için farklı olarak sunulan içeriği ifade eder. Bu tür içerikler genellikle daha uzun sürede yüklenir. Ancak, web cache kullanarak dinamik içeriklerinizi optimize edebilirsiniz. Cache, sıkça kullanılan verileri geçici olarak saklayarak, her seferinde sunucudan yeniden alınmasını engeller ve sayfa yükleme hızını artırır.
Özellikle e-ticaret sitelerinde ve haber sitelerinde, cache kullanımı site hızını artırmanın vazgeçilmez bir yoludur.4. Gzip Sıkıştırma ile Sayfa Yükleme Süresi Nasıl Düşürülür?
Gzip, web sayfalarınızın boyutunu küçültmek için kullanılan bir sıkıştırma yöntemidir. HTML, CSS ve JavaScript dosyalarını sıkıştırarak, daha hızlı yüklenmelerini sağlar. Bu basit yöntemle, sayfa yükleme süresini %70'e kadar azaltabilirsiniz.
Gzip'i aktif hale getirmek, hız optimizasyonu açısından küçük ama etkili bir adımdır.5. Veritabanı Optimizasyonu: Gereksiz Veri Nasıl Temizlenir?
Web sitenizdeki veritabanı ne kadar verimli çalışıyorsa, site hızınız o kadar iyi olur. Gereksiz veri, eski içerik ve şişmiş tablolar, veritabanınızın performansını düşürür. Veritabanı optimizasyonu, sık kullanılan verilerin hızlı bir şekilde erişilebilmesini sağlar.
Veritabanınızı düzenli olarak temizlemek ve optimize etmek, hız artışı sağlamak için önemli bir adımdır.6. PHP Versiyon Güncellemeleri ve Performansa Etkisi
PHP, web sitenizin çalışmasını sağlayan temel teknolojilerden biridir. PHP'nin eski sürümleri, hız konusunda zayıf performans gösterebilir. Bu nedenle, PHP'nin en son sürümüne geçmek, hız artışı sağlamak adına önemli bir adımdır. PHP 7 ve sonrası, önceki sürümlere göre daha hızlı ve verimli çalışır.
PHP sürümünü güncellemek, sadece güvenlik değil, aynı zamanda hız açısından da faydalıdır.7. HTTP/2 ile Hız Nasıl Artırılır?
HTTP/2, eski HTTP/1.1 protokolüne göre çok daha hızlı veri iletimi sağlar. HTTP/2, sunucudan gelen veri akışını daha verimli hale getirir ve paralel veri akışına imkan verir. Bu, özellikle çok sayıda küçük dosya ile çalışan sitelerde büyük bir hız farkı yaratabilir.
HTTP/2 protokolünü destekleyen bir hosting seçmek, site hızınızı artırabilir.8. Hata Günlüklerini İzleme ve Performans İyileştirme
Web sunucunuzda oluşan hatalar, site performansını olumsuz etkileyebilir. Sunucu hata günlüklerini düzenli olarak kontrol etmek, sorunları tespit etmenize yardımcı olur. Bu hatalar genellikle fazla yüklenmeye ya da yazılım hatalarına işaret eder.
Hata güncellemelerini izlemek, sisteminizdeki aksaklıkları tespit ederek hız optimizasyonu yapmanızı sağlar.9. Statik Dosyaların Sıkıştırılması ve Hız Artışı
Statik dosyalar, web sayfalarınızda yer alan resimler, videolar ve yazılımlar gibi içerik türleridir. Bu dosyalar, sayfanın yüklenme süresini artırabilir. Statik dosyalarınızı sıkıştırmak ve doğru formatlarda sunmak, sayfa hızını artırır.
Özellikle büyük resim dosyalarını optimize etmek, önemli bir hız artışı sağlayacaktır.10. Sunucu Konfigürasyonu ve Optimizasyon Tüyoları
Sunucu konfigürasyonu, performansı doğrudan etkileyen bir diğer önemli faktördür. Sunucunuzun doğru yapılandırılması, sitenizin daha hızlı çalışmasını sağlar. Sunucu ayarlarını optimize ederek, gereksiz yükleri ve talepleri azaltabilirsiniz.
Sunucu ayarlarını doğru yapılandırmak, her açıdan performans iyileştirmeleri yapmanıza olanak tanır.Sonuç
Web hosting performansını artırmak, yalnızca SEO değil, kullanıcı deneyimi için de kritik öneme sahiptir. Küçük ama etkili optimizasyonlarla, web sitenizin hızını önemli ölçüde artırabilir ve ziyaretçi memnuniyetini sağlayabilirsiniz. Bu 10 yöntemi uygulayarak, sitenizin hızını optimize edebilir ve sıralamalarda daha yüksek bir yere ulaşabilirsiniz.